FHRAI encourages growth
Appreciating this phenomenon, the FHRAI (Federation of Hotel & Restaurant
Associations of India), has decided to host its 43rd FHRAI Annual Convention
and tradeshow this year in the bustling city of Kolkata with a view to encourage
development here. The event is being held from October 26 to 28, 2007 at ITC
Hotel Sonar - undoubtedly one of Kolkata's most luxurious five-star deluxe hotel
properties.
The theme of the convention this year is 'Hospitality and Government - Creating
Prosperity Together', that indicates the need of the hospitality industry and
the government to work in unison. Spread over three days, it will be attended
not only by FHRAI members from across India but will also witness attendance
from high-profile industry professionals from the eastern region.

Appreciating achievers
Apart from discussions on critical issues, the forum will also feature an award
function to recognise admirable performances in the industry of both individuals
and organisations. The individual awards have been instituted by FHRAI to encourage
entrepreneurship, talent, professionalism and commitment towards efficiency.
The individual achievers will be facilitated across the following categories:
- Young Hotel Entrepreneur of the Year
- Young Restaurant Entrepreneur of the Year Manager
Award
- Young General Manager of the Year
- Young Hotel F&B Manager of the Year
- Young Hotel Chef of the Year
- Young Hotel Front Office Manager/Rooms Division
Manager of the Year
- Young Hotel Housekeeper of the Year
- Young Hotel Sales & Marketing Manager of
the Year
- Young Hotel Restaurant Manager of the Year
- Young Hotel HR Manager of the Year
- Young Hotel Training Manager of the Year
- Young Hotel Engineer of the Year
- Young Independent Restaurant Manager of the Year
- Revenue Manager of the Year Award.
Similarly, organisational awards have been instituted to encourage and promote
environmentally best practices in the industry. FHRAI will be facilitating companies
across the following segments:
- Environment Champion of the Year among Large
Hotels
- Environment Champion of the Year among Small
Hotels
- Environment Champion of the Year among Restaurants
Two awards will be given in each segment - for the winners and the runners-up.
